Our Friendship is a Work of Art

Good morning! Dropping by this morning with an artsy Reverse Confetti Card!


I knew I wanted to use this pattern paper for my card - I love the artsy paintbrush type of stripes - which seemed like a perfect fit for the sentiments and images from Work of Art. I stamped those on a label from Hello and Thanks Label Confetti Cuts, and added a bit of distress ink to the edges to soften it and help it blend with the background paper a bit. I added a couple frames cut with All Framed Up Confetti Cuts from Flamingo and Stone cardstocks, and a bit of jute twine to finish it off!

Pineapple Summer!

Good morning! I'm dropping by this morning with anther card using some of the fabulous NEW Simon Says Stamp One of a Kind Release! Today I used the fun Dancing Fruits Stamp Set - I just LOVE these pineapples!


I used a few different colors of SSS inks to create an ombre effect on these pineapples. So easy and fun and adds so much depth to them! I trimmed a bit off the bottom of the card and backed it with a strip of black cardstock cut with a scallop border die, then added some gold washi tape on the border. Finished off with a splattering of gold watercolors and a few enamel dots - and rounded off one corner!
